Following the success of our first Care Conversations event, Your GP and Home Instead are delighted to invite you to our next sessions, focusing on Brain Health. Taking place on Sunday June 28th and Thursday July 2nd, these events will explore an issue that affects many of us, whether personally or through caring for a loved one.
At YourGP and Home Instead we understand that concerns about brain health can feel overwhelming, particularly as we age. Whether you're experiencing concerns yourself, caring for a loved one, or simply looking to learn more, it's important to know that support is available.
Join us for an informative discussion with YourGP’s Medical Director, Dr Cathrow and Andrew Senew, Director of Home Instead Edinburgh, where we'll explore brain health, answer your questions, and provide practical advice and guidance.
Attendees will also have the opportunity to book a complimentary 20-minute initial consultation with YourGP to discuss any aspect of brain health with one of their experts.
Light refreshments and fizz will be provided, alongside plenty of opportunities to listen, share experiences, and ask questions.
YourGP, 53 Dundas Street, Edinburgh, EH3 6RS
Sunday June 28th | 1-3pm & Thursday July 2nd | 6:30-8pm
Free to attend – registration via the link below is encouraged to assist us with catering.
